DEPARTMENT OF SPECIAL EDUCATION & CLINICAL SERVICES Speech-Language Pathology Program Indiana University of Pennsylvania anticipates a tenure-track position in the Speech-Language Pathology Program/Department of Special Education & Clinical Services at the Assistant/Associate Professor level to begin Fall, 1996. Qualifications: CCC-SLP. Doctorate in Communication Disorders or Sciences. Ability to teach and supervise at the university level and evidence of scholarly activity. Highest preference will be given to applicants with a clinical orientation who are also qualified to teach speech science. Duties: Include teaching Master's level courses, supervision of clinical practica, teaching and advising in an undergraduate program, scholarly work in the field, and related university and community service.
